Job Summary

  • Lead sophisticated visual neuroscience experiments and access world-class imaging and microscopy platforms.
  • Conduct advanced in vivo and ex vivo imaging and microsurgery in rodents, focusing on retina, optic nerve and brain.
  • Supervise and train students and lab members, contributing to a safe, well-resourced and collegial laboratory environment.

Key Requirements

  • PhD in visual sciences, neuroscience or related
  • Strong publication or funding track record
  • Substantial hands-on experience in rodent imaging and microsurgery
  • Experience with advanced microscopy and analysis software
